linux路由linux路由跟踪命令是什么

2024-08-12 09:19:47 浏览

在Linux系统中,可以使用以下命令来查看路由信息:

linux路由linux路由跟踪是什么

1. route命令:该命令可以显示和操作内核IP路由表,使用如下格式

route [-n] [add|del] [网络地址] [掩码长度] [网关地址]

-n:使用数字格式显示;

网络地址:目标网络地址;

掩码长度:目标子网掩码长度;

2. ip命令:该命令可以显示和操作网络接口、地址、路由和隧道等,使用如下格式:

show:显示当前的路由表。

3. netstat命令:该命令可以显示网络状态信息,包括路由信息,使用如下格式:

1.主机路由主机路由是路由选择表中指向单个IP地址或主机名的路由记录。主机路由的Flags字段为H。例如,在下面的示例中,本地主机通过IP地址192.168.1.1的路由器到达IP地址为10.0.0.10的主机。

2.网络路由是代表主机可以到达的网络。网络路由的Flags字段为N。例如,在下面的示例中,本地主机将发送到网络192.19.12.12的数据包转发到IP地址为192.168.1.1的路由器。

3.默认路由:当主机不能在路由表中查找到目标主机的IP地址或网络路由时,数据包就被发送到默认路由(默认网关)上。默认路由的Flags字段为G。例如,在下面的示例中,默认路由是IP地址为192.168.1.1的路由器。

要在Linux上永久保存路由,您可以执行以下步骤:

2. 使用“route -n”命令查看当前路由表。

3. 使用“route add -net”命令添加永久路由。语法如下:

其中,是要访问的网络,是目标网络的子网掩码,是要访问目标网络的网关地址。

4. 使用“route -n”命令再次查看路由表,以确认永久路由已成功添加。

5. 使用“service network save”或“/etc/init.d/network save”命令将路由表保存到文件中,以便在系统重启后自动加载。这将在/etc/sysconfig/network-scripts目录下创建一个ifcfg-eth0文件,其中包含路由表信息。

这样,您就可以在Linux上永久保存路由。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。